We love seeing how many people continue to make great swaps to cut out plastic and harmful chemicals in their daily kitchen routines:
- Brushes made with natural fibres like agave or coconut on beech wood handles for daily washing up and bottle cleaning
- Coconut fibre pads or scrubbers for tougher jobs
- Luffa sponges made entirely from the insides of plants, which can be composted after use
- Solid soap bars for general washing up, cutting grease, removing stains and more
- Household gloves made from compostable natural rubber
- Reusable cloths and towels made from bamboo or organic cotton, to be washed and used over and over rather than discarded
- Beeswax or candelilla (vegan) wraps to cover bowls or plates of leftovers, or to wrap snacks on the go, all of which can be refreshed with rewax bars
- Dustpans, squeegees, scouring sponges and more in durable materials, with components that can be dismantled at end of life for composting
or recycling
